Mojito Pop Up Bars at Brightline Hi-Speed Train Stations – South Florida

Mojito – the unofficial cocktail of Super Bowl is made with Bacardí Rum added to a muddled mix of fresh Lime Wedges, fresh Mint Leaves and Confectioners’ Sugar in a crushed ice-filled glass that is topped off with Club Soda, then, garnished with a Sprig of fresh mint.

Kiki on the River – Miami

The riverside restaurant is Miami’s top indoor/outdoor nightlife and dining destination. Kiki on the River embraces the hospitality and spirit of the Greek islands with the service and style of a romantic island garden restaurant and lounge. 

For the Big Game. Chef Steve Rhee’s menu celebrates both teams. The Dungeness Crab Cake Sandwich is the perfect item for the 49ers fans, while Kiki’s barbecued Baby Back Ribs won’t disappoint those supporting the Kansas City Chiefs. Kiki wouldn’t throw a party without cocktails, so check out these drinks especially created to celebrate each team.

The 49ers

Ketel One Vodka, fresh Lime Juice, St Germain, Simple Syrup topped with Champagne. And garnished with fresh Blackberries, Raspberries and Lime Wheel. By glass or Large Format version,(serves 4-6 guests).

The Chiefs

Bullit Bourbon, Mint Simple Syrup, fresh Lemon Juice and freshly brewed Ice Tea; garnished with fresh Blackberries. By the glass, or Large Format version, (serves 4-6 guests).

Big Game Big Give presented by Oasis House

Each year, The Giving Back Fund holds its “Big Game Big Give” fundraising event at a private estate in the Super Bowl city the weekend of the big game. This star-studded gala has become a favorite among the philanthropy elite, with previous celebrity hosts including Alec Baldwin, Chris “Ludacris” Bridges, Mark Wahlberg, Hilary Swank, Ashton Kutcher, Demi Moore, Josh Brolin, Jaime Foxx, Michael Phelps, and David Schwimmer. 

For the 2020 event’s cocktail party will be co-hosted by filmmaker Michael Bay and Breaking Bad star’s Bryan Cranston and Aaron Paul.  The evening will treat guests to a live performance by Academy Award-winning actor and singer Jamie Foxx. Pro Football Hall of Famer, All-Time leading rusher for The Cleveland Browns, American football legend and social activist Jim Brown will be honored with a philanthropic award, presented by Pro Football Hall of Famer and Super Bowl XXXV MVP Ray Lewis. The event will also feature celebrity performances, a live auction, curated cocktail stations and catering by award-winning chef Adrianne Calvo.

Big Game Big Give presented by Oasis House is a premiere A-list event that will benefit national philanthropic advancement and local Miami nonprofits including Sylvester Comprehensive Cancer Center. The gala is thrown annually in the Super Bowl’s host city and has been voted the number one Super Bowl party by ESPN The Magazine.

UNKNWN + Nike Team Up With Talented Women of Miami for Super Bowl LIV Event

Mirroring the electricity of Super Bowl LIV as it descends on Miami, UNKNWN debuts a one-of-a-kind experience in partnership with Nike and the NFL at their recently opened flagship shopping destination in Wynwood. Co-founded by LeBron James, Jaron Kanfer and Frankie Walker Jr., UNKNWN was created to be a platform for the community using fashion, sport, art and culture. 

Collaborating with a talented collective of powerful women who call Miami a source of inspiration, UNKNWN Wynwood will be transformed into the Nike’s tagline “Future is in the Air” presented by Nike to celebrate a female point of view over the weekend of sport. The multi-sensory experience, “created by women for everyone,” will also be the perfect launching pad for Nike’s first women’s exclusive Air Max shoe: The Air Verona.The event will celebrate the global arrival of the sneakers with an exclusive colorway, which will be exclusively sold at UNKNWN over Super Bowl weekend

Taking over the exterior walls of the main courtyard at UNKNWN, Miami born artist Jessy Nite will be debuting an exclusive football-inspired piece inspired by the NFL’s theme “First and Everything”. The notable visual artist, best known for her large scale, outdoor text installations, will be working with UNKNWN’s 6000 sq. ft. of workable surface and unlimited air space. Street art fans will be able to visit Nite’s transformation of UNKNWN beginning on Thursday, January 30, 2020.

Powered by Nike, Friday and Saturday mornings will commence with football inspired classes in Nite’s newly painted courtyard space with yoga instructor Cristina Ortega on loan from SOL YOGA Wynwood and a work out from Elise Caldwell of Wynwood’s DBC Fitness. Port de Stella at Super Bowl LIV

Not into football, but want to celebrate anyway? Head to The Wharf in downtown Miami for Port De Stella.  Port de Stella Miami, a weekend-long event hosted by Stella Artois, will feature a European-style marketplace, pop-up restaurants from celebrated European chefs, musical performances and hands-on “Stella Session” demonstrations from artisans, experts and celebrities like Priyanka Chopra Jonas and Karamo Brown – among other style and tastemakers like Cedric Gervais, Sofi Tukker and DJ Irie.

In partnership with restaurant discovery platform The Infatuation, Port de Stella attendees will have the chance to experience three of Europe’s best restaurants – available in the U.S. for the first time. They will feature Roscioli Salumeria con Cucina – (Rome, Italy), Frenchie (Paris, France) and  Sanchez (Copenhagen, Denmark). Visitors will have the ability to make reservations for a one-of-a-kind, three-course meal.
